You have the base idea of a model down, but you still could use some small details. Things like a ladder on the outside (or at least a door to a internal ladder) or a hatch and barrier on the roof.

I understand that its your first building, and its good for that , but next time take details into account it will make it look much better.

Constructive comment?....1. Open a thread and read the comments people give you...2. Use "dirtier" or "used" textures on your models. This one's too clean. 3. Add more details to your models. This one looks like it has only two pieces on top of each other....and finally check and doublecheck the size and dimensions of your BAT (this is hard, I myself still have problems with it) Your model seems to be a little too small. Good start though. ;)
